IFIM School of Technology Scholarships and Funding

1. Scholarship for Economically Weaker Sections (EWS):

The EWS scholarship will be 100% and will cover tuition and hostel fees (Registration fees as per course will be charged).

Eligibility Criteria: To avail the EWS scholarship the following criteria shall be observed-

- The income criteria for EWS shall be that the family income should be below Rs 5 lac per annum.
- The candidate should have undergone the IFIM selection process and earned qualifying marks prescribed for the EWS - scholarships and have been recommended by the ASP panel and approved by the Director.

2. Merit Scholarship:

The merit scholarships will be equivalent to 50 and 25 percent of the tuition fee based on the scholarship criteria.

Eligibility Criteria: To avail of the merit scholarship-

- Candidate should have undergone the IFIM selection process
- Earned qualifying marks prescribed for the merit scholarships

Q:   What are the criteria for continuing scholarships at IFIM School of Technology?
A:

Candidates are required to maintain 80% and above in each semester through the course to continue the IFIM School of Technology scholarship. The attendance should be 80% and above throughout. Besides, students should not have any backlogs in any of the semesters during the course of study. 

The renewal of scholarship must be done on time with submission of the marksheet copy of each semester. The student is considered only for the scholarship throughout the course.

Good placement opportunities, decent faculty, infrastructure, and a vibrant campus life.

Placements: Around 85% of students get placed. The highest package is 23 LPA, the lowest is 3.5 LPA, and the average is around 6.8 LPA. Top recruiters include TCS, Infosys, Wipro, and Deloitte. About 70% of students get internships in companies like EY, IBM, and Keep Learning. The top roles are Developer and Analyst.
